It is first against second this weekend when Knaresborough face Eccleshill United at Manse Lane. It will our first league game since our 4-0 home win over Retford a couple of weeks ago due to the wet weather. We currently have a 15 point lead over Eccleshill with Grimsby Borough 3 points further behind with all teams having played 35 games. So the game will have a big bearing on the automatic promotion outcome.
We played on Thursday when a much changed team put up a great display when losing 4-2 to Handsworth Parramore from the Premier division.
Goals from Nick Black and Dan Clayton had given us a 2-0 lead but we were unable to hold.
Eccleshill played their game in hand midweek and had a 1-1 draw away at Winterton as they conceded an injury time equaliser. Luke Harrop was their scorer on the night. Eccleshill have only lost once in their last 6 matches but have drawn 3 of them which has allowed us to extend the gap between us at the top of the table. Our previous encounter in the league back in November was our first defeat of the season. Eccleshill were excellent on the day and deserved their 5-2 win against us. Goals from Brad Walker and Will Lenehan got our goals on the day.
